Copper Fittings Demystified
Although the underground drainage system is a central part of getting waste water away from any building, it’s important not to forget how the clean water gets to that building. This is where copper fittings make their very important appearance.
With the various shapes, sizes and fittings, it is very understandable that people can often become completely baffled by the catalogue of products there are out there. However this blog looks to demystify these vital plumbing components and outline a clear understanding of what they do and how they work.
The easiest way to break down the seemingly never-ending catalogue of copper fittings is to group them by the way in which they are fitted for purpose:
Solder Ring Fittings
Within the plumbing and guttering supplies industry, these fittings can also be known as Yorkshire fittings. This is where the copper fitting contains some already cooled solder within the inside of the connecting area. When the fitting is connected to the adjoining pipework, cleaning solution along with heat is applied for the pre-placed solder to melt and attach to the newly adjoined pipework. Once the solder has cooled, it will harden to form a watertight bond between the pipework and fitting.
End Feed Fittings
Almost identical to solder ring fittings, the end feed fittings do not contain the solder within the piping; instead the plumber will have a reel of solder in which is then heated and applied to the fitting where needed.
Compression Fittings
This type of fitting is typically made of brass with the use of a thin copper band to make the join watertight. This fitting uses mechanical pressure in order to tightly make the join and squeeze the copper band into position.
Push-Fit Fittings
This particular design of fitting uses a stop-ring mechanism which grabs and forms a watertight bond when the specially designed plastic pipes are fed through the fitting. Upon the flow of water through the pipes, it strengthens the bond ensuring its strength and watertight feature.
